Lionfish
A breathtaking monarch armed with venomous spines and an invasive ambition that threatens entire reefs.
The lionfish is a living paradox: a creature of hypnotic beauty that masks a devastating ecological appetite. With vibrant red-and-white stripes and flowing fins resembling a regal mane, it commands attention in the Indo-Pacific, where it plays a balanced role as a mid-level predator. Yet, outside its native range, this elegance becomes a weapon. In the Atlantic and Caribbean, lacking natural checks on their population, these voracious hunters decimate juvenile reef fish faster than they can reproduce, unraveling food webs and threatening the very foundations of local biodiversity.

Lore & Background
In the warm, complex currents of the Indo-Pacific, lionfish are held in check by a natural order. Native predators like groupers and sharks patrol their territory, while evolution has gifted these fish with a potent defense: venomous spines rather than speed. This strategy allows them to ambush prey from the shadows of coral crevices where larger hunters cannot follow. The invasion of the Western Atlantic remains one of marine biology's most chilling mysteries, likely sparked by careless aquarium releases or storm-driven dispersal. Finding no natural enemies in this new world, their numbers exploded. A single female can release thousands of buoyant eggs every few days, creating a biological cascade that overwhelms native ecosystems. Humanity's relationship with the lionfish is now defined by a tense duality: divers admire its alien grace from a safe distance to avoid the agonizing sting, while fishermen are urged to hunt it for its mild, delicious flesh. This culinary counter-offensive represents our best hope of restoring balance to reefs ravaged by human error.

Reader's Guide
While native to the Indo-Pacific's warm lagoons and rocky crevices, where their stripes provide perfect camouflage against coral, lionfish have aggressively colonized the Atlantic. There, they exploit similar vertical structures—from shallow reefs to deeper slopes—to execute efficient ambush tactics. Unlike in their homeland, where predators keep them in check, these invasive populations face little resistance, allowing them to outcompete native species for food and space. As voracious carnivores, they possess a gape that allows them to swallow prey nearly half their own size, decimating stocks of small fish and crustaceans. Their success lies not just in hunger, but in their unique ability to corner prey with their fanned fins before striking with lethal precision.
Did You Know?
- Lionfish can reproduce every few days, releasing up to two million eggs per year.
- Their venom causes intense pain but is rarely fatal to humans with proper treatment.
- Native predators in the Indo-Pacific have evolved specific behaviors to avoid their spines.
- Eating lionfish helps control invasive populations and supports local economies.
